About:
Jennifer Abrams shares her thoughts as an educator and the inspiration leading to the writing of several books, including “Having Hard Conversations.” She discusses the importance of educators improving their practices and becoming a professional learning community. This transformation involves developing communication skills of individuals to strengthen collaboration of the professional learning community. Jennifer Abrams shares her upcoming book, “Stretching Your Learning Edges: Growing (Up) at Work,” to be released on April 30.

About Jennifer Abrams
Jennifer has been recognized as one of "21 Women All K-12 Educators Need to Know" by Education Week's 'Finding Common Ground' blog. She considers herself a "voice coach," helping others learn how to best use their voices – be it collaborating on a team, facilitating a group, coaching a colleague, supervising an employee and being an all around better human being in all types of interactions.
